From 67bae96d76fd23c39b5761824215579fc535194c Mon Sep 17 00:00:00 2001 From: PeiYong Zhang <peiyongz@apache.org> Date: Tue, 22 Oct 2002 15:00:44 +0000 Subject: [PATCH] Add ICUMsgLoader on Window2 git-svn-id: https://svn.apache.org/repos/asf/xerces/c/trunk@174288 13f79535-47bb-0310-9956-ffa450edef68 --- src/xercesc/util/Platforms/Win32/Win32PlatformUtils.cpp |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/xercesc/util/Platforms/Win32/Win32PlatformUtils.cpp b/src/xercesc/util/Platforms/Win32/Win32PlatformUtils.cpp index f7df540d3..28f21b080 100644 --- a/src/xercesc/util/Platforms/Win32/Win32PlatformUtils.cpp +++ b/src/xercesc/util/Platforms/Win32/Win32PlatformUtils.cpp @@ -103,6 +103,8 @@ #include <xercesc/util/MsgLoaders/InMemory/InMemMsgLoader.hpp> #elif defined (XML_USE_WIN32_MSGLOADER) #include <xercesc/util/MsgLoaders/Win32/Win32MsgLoader.hpp> +#elif defined(XML_USE_ICU_MESSAGELOADER) + #include <xercesc/util/MsgLoaders/ICU/ICUMsgLoader.hpp> #else #error A message loading service must be chosen #endif @@ -862,6 +864,8 @@ XMLMsgLoader* XMLPlatformUtils::loadAMsgSet(const XMLCh* const msgDomain) return new InMemMsgLoader(msgDomain); #elif defined (XML_USE_WIN32_MSGLOADER) return new Win32MsgLoader(msgDomain); +#elif defined (XML_USE_ICU_MESSAGELOADER) + return new ICUMsgLoader(msgDomain); #else #error You must provide a message loader #endif -- GitLab